"New Director Joins CTC Communications Corp.
WALTHAM, Mass.--Feb. 2, 1999--CTC Communications Corp. (NASDAQ:CPTL) today
announced that Mr. Carl Redfield has been elected to its Board of Directors
effective on January 19, 1999.
Mr. Redfield, a corporate officer of Cisco Systems, Inc. (Nasdaq NNM:CSCO),
joined Cisco in August 1993 as Director, Supply/Demand of Manufacturing and
became Vice President of Manufacturing in September 1993. Mr. Redfield became
Senior Vice President, Manufacturing and Logistics in February 1997. Prior to
joining Cisco, he spent eighteen years at Digital Equipment Company, most
recently as Group Manufacturing and Logistics Manager of the PC Group. Mr.
Redfield also serves as a member of the Board of Directors of VA Research
Inc. and Paragon Electronics Inc., both California companies.

CTC is a rapidly growing provider of integrated communications solutions to
medium and large-sized business customers in the Northeast U.S. It provides
an extensive array of voice and data services including local, long distance,
frame relay, Internet access, and other advanced data services. The Company
markets its service through its 175 member direct sales force located in 25
branch offices throughout Massachusetts, New York, Connecticut, New
Hampshire, Vermont, Rhode Island, Maine and Maryland. CTC's headquarters is
in Waltham, Massachusetts. CTC can be found on the worldwide web at
